Results for Indian Embassy In Turkey

Loading Results
Related Searches
indian embassy in turkey
indian embassy in turkey email address
indian embassy in turkey address
indian consulate in turkey
turkey consulate in india
indian embassy in turkmenistan
turkey embassy in mumbai
indian embassy in ankara
embassy of turkey in delhi
embassy of turkey in islamabad
Loading Additional Information